摘要
A new ultrasonic method for regeneration of granular activated carbon was developed. Experimental results showed that the method was effective. The operation,time and type of ultrasound, the kind of adsorbate, and the size of granular carbon were investigated in the process of ultrasonic regeneration. The ultrasonic regeneration has many advantages, such as lower energy consumption, simpler process equipment, lower carbon loss, higher recovery of valuable substances, etc.
